Texting Messages stem out number of fatal accidents

September 22, 2008 · Filed Under News · Comment 

image BBC

A study shows that a growing number of people use cellphones for text messaging instead of phone calls particularly by teenagers. Many teenagers give preferentiality to them to actually talking. Almost overnight, text messages have become the favored way of communication for millions.

But as they can pose danger by distracting users, those messages are coming under increasing fire day by day. Number of serious accidents stem from texting while driving, crossing the street or engaging in other activities is on the rise, as proved by various evidences though lacking official casualty statistics.

Paul Saffo, a technology trend forecaster in Silicon Valley stated that10 I.Q. points get removed automatically by act of texting.

After federal investigators declared that a train engineer’s text-messaging may possibly have played a role in the country’s most fatal commuter rail accident in four decades The California Public Utilities Commission announced an emergency measure on Thursday in the most recent reaction in opposition to text-messaging provisionally prohibiting the use of all mobile devices by anyone at the controls of a moving train.

As the technology has improved with the introduction of products like the Apple iPhone, the application has increased speedily in the last few years in the United States. According to CTIA — the Wireless Association, the leading industry trade group in US 7.2 billion text massages were sent in June 2005 while in this June, 75 billion text messages were sent.

USA Takes Lead in IPv6, Next-Gen Internet Equipment Certifications

September 18, 2008 · Filed Under News · Comment 

ATLANTA, Sept 17, 2008 - InfoWeapons, provider of next generation Internet Protocol (IPv6) appliances and secure applications, announces helping the U.S. move into the lead in “IPv6 Ready” Gold level certifications worldwide, for the first time. IPv6 is positioned to be the standard protocol for the next-generation Internet, by 2010. As of August 2008, the U.S. has 68 Gold certified products compared with 53 from Japan (2nd place), 23 from Taiwan (3rd place) and 19 from China (4th place).
The total number of IPv6 Ready gold certified products worldwide is 181.

“IPv6 will be the ‘deep Internet infrastructure’ of the 21st Century, driving the next generation of telephony, broadcast entertainment, smart sensor and control networks, online gaming, and more,” says Lawrence E. Hughes, founder and chairman of InfoWeapons. “After years of lonely pioneering, I’m thrilled and gratified to see IPv6 coming to life in the USA.”

The U.S. uses roughly 70% of all the available, IPv4 addresses. Asia, which has the largest populations and the highest growth rates of new Internet users, has been most aggressive in adoption and implementation of IPv6. Europe is in second place with the U.S. and the Rest of the World (ROW) among the slowest adopters. Japan, Korea and China view this as a once in a lifetime opportunity to take over leadership and control of the Internet in the 21st Century. Each continues to invest heavily in IPv6.

“Since it takes up to 2 years to migrate to IPv6, ARIN (America Registry for Internet Numbers) and RIPE (Reseaux IP Europeens), respectively the U.S. and EU organizations in charge of IP address allocation, have warned all organizations in their regions to start migration immediately, or face unnecessary costs and disruption,” said Luis Gopez, CEO of InfoWeapons.
“This urgency is finally leading U.S. companies to invest in IPv6 product development and service deployment.”

The World Converts To IPv6 By 2010

IPv6 is the next generation Internet Protocol. Today’s IPv4 TCP/IP runs out of addresses in August 2010, based upon the current uptake of IP Addresses. The next-generation, IPv6 with a 128-bit address space, enables an enormously greater number of new devices and services, replacing IPv4 within 10 years. Although some applications can run over either IPv4 or IPv6, newer applications, features, and functionalities will increasingly require IPv6. These include Voice over Internet Protocol (VoIP), Internet Protocol TeleVision (IPTV), Peer-to-Peer (P2P) direct communications, and Virtual Private Networks (VPN). Taiwan, alone, plans to connect about 3 billion devices to the Internet by 2010. Globally, this implies an explosion in the number of devices and services.

Samsung’s Offer of $5.85 Billion for SanDisk is rejected

September 17, 2008 · Filed Under News · Comment 

A Silicon Valley maker of flash memory cards that are vital components of famous devices like MP3 music players and digital cameras SanDisk has rejected $5.85 billion cash offer by Samsung Electronics, the South Korean consumer electronics giant.

Samsung presented to pay $26 a share for SanDisk, above 90 percent over its closing price of $15.04 in an offer initially made in August and exposed to investors following the American markets closed Tuesday.

As investors responded to the spontaneous bid SanDisk shares went up almost 50 percent to approximately $23 in after-hours trading.

But SanDisk rejected the proposal made by Samsung Electronics but would not rule out the deal at a better price.

Every year Samsung Electronics pays almost $350 million to use SanDisk’s patented flesh technology. Purchase of SanDisk would help the company to cut this cost as well as broaden the South Korean firm’s leadership in flash memory market as the industry is struggling with sharp memory chip price falls due to supply superfluity.

SanDisk stated that Samsung Electronics offer is underestimating the company’s value and rejected the deal though it stated that it is open for the deal with Samsung Electronics at a price which is justifiable for the company’s value.

According to Samsung’s spokesperson the company yet not decided whether it will raise its bid.

Computer maker Dell rattled investors as it sees cutbacks in its computers and servers sector

September 17, 2008 · Filed Under News · 4 Comments 

On Tuesday computer maker Dell expressed that dropping demand for technology equipment across the globe was distressing its business. It distressed its investors by saying that its customers are losing their interest in spending on computers and servers. This implication triggered a plunge of over 11 percent in the price of the company’s stock.

Tuesday Dell closed at $15.98, losing $2.01.

For below stellar financial results, Dell has often named unexciting demand for technology. Dell said that turn down in expenditure added to a 17 percent fall in quarterly profit. In the beginning of September in a Securities and Exchange Commission filing, it said that it intended to contract its worldwide network of factories however in August; Dell cautioned that dimness in spending in the United States had carried over to Europe and Asia.

Brian T. Gladden- Dell’s chief financial officer sated Tuesday that they faced very feeble August.

Dell is feeling force of the slowing economy ahead of some major rivals because of its reliance on business spending, and on the government, military and education sectors. Merely approximately 20 percent of Dell’s revenue comes from consumers.
